The garage occupancy feed for the Brindlewood campus arrives over a message queue every thirty seconds, one record per level, published by the Stallgrid edge boxes. Counts can briefly go negative when a sensor double-fires on exit; the ingest job clamps these to zero and flags the interval. If the feed stalls for more than five minutes, the dashboard falls back to the last known snapshot. Sensor mappings, queue names, and the replay procedure are documented on the internal page below.

runbook for tahog-kadug: https://gitlab.qirvanworks.corp/projects/pages/view/b139298aed28

Subject: Launch Plan — Solvaire Home Hub. Team, attached is the phased launch plan for Solvaire, beginning with a limited release in the Carlingden region before national rollout eight weeks later. Finance should note the revised tooling amortisation schedule and the contingency of 6% built into the channel-marketing budget. Pricing holds at the level approved in March pending competitor response. The forecast assumptions underpinning this plan are set out below.

board note of baguf-fafog: Kasixox Foods plans to lower the Drueth list price by 48 percent in March.

Hey Marisol — handing off the Plottica address autocomplete widget before the sync. Debounce logic is solid now, but the fallback provider still flakes on rural lookups, so keep an eye on retry counts. Tests pass locally and in staging. Everything the widget needs at runtime is listed directly below.

service settings:
[julix]
host = julix.sivrelcloud.internal
user = julix_svc
database = julix_prod